Texans have plenty of reasons to oust Speaker Joe Straus. We’ve highlighted the Top 12 reasons leading up to the election.



1.  Joe Straus agrees with Barack Obama: “we can’t cut your way to prosperity”.

2.  Straus voted for a payroll tax that would have increased the overall tax burden on 80% of Texans before becoming Speaker of the House. (HB 3, RV 119, 79th Legislature)

3.  Joe Straus voted to levy a “granny tax” on nursing home residents (HB 3778, RV 1048, 80th Legislature)

4.  Straus’ family is set to make millions when gambling is legalized in Texas.

5.  Straus punishes conservatives. A pro-Straus Republican is on record admitting so.

6.  Straus headlined a fundraiser for liberal Democrat Patrick Rose… who ran against conservative Republican Jason Isaac.

7.  Straus claims he’s a pro-life conservative, despite receiving a 100% rating from NARAL, receiving a $1,000 check from Planned Parenthood, and calling pro-life issues “campaign fodder.”

8.  Joe Straus refuses to sign the Taxpayer Pledge or support the Texas Budget Compact.

9.  “Centrist” Joe Straus rose to power during the “Democratic Wave that swept President Obama into office.”

10.  Straus appointed pro-gambling committee chairs, including one who moved districts to challenge a conservative.

11.  Liberal Democrats in the Texas House “can’t think of a better person to lead us…”

12.  Texas had a near super-majority of Republicans in both houses, but still couldn’t get spending caps passed under Straus’ leadership.
